Summary

Fair Grove Elementary is a PK–5 school in Thomasville, NC, serving 524 students within Davidson County Schools, where virtually the entire student body (99.4%) qualifies for free or reduced lunch. The school currently holds a 2-star rating and ranks in the 41st percentile statewide, though its performance history shows significant swings—from a 78th-percentile showing in 2015-16 down to the 31st percentile in 2018-19, then back up to the 69th percentile in 2022-23 before drifting down again in recent years.

The school’s most distinctive academic pattern is a sharp divide between upper-grade math and science, where students excel, and early literacy, where they struggle. In 5th grade, 77.4% of students scored proficient in math and 79.6% in science—both well above district and state averages, and among the best in the area. However, reading proficiency lags badly, especially in 3rd grade, where just 37.2% of students are proficient compared to roughly 55% statewide—an 18-point gap. This weakness shows up against nearby same-district schools as well: Hasty Elementary, Davis-Townsend Elementary, Pilot Elementary, and Brier Creek Elementary all post higher 3rd- and 4th-grade reading scores. Even in early-grade math, Fair Grove trails these peers significantly, creating a "barbell" profile of strong 5th-grade results but weak foundational skills.

There are some bright spots worth noting. Hispanic students at Fair Grove rank at the 74th percentile compared to similar students statewide, and low-income students perform at the 57th percentile—both better than the school's overall ranking would suggest. Chronic absenteeism, while rising from 10.0% to 14.8% in one year, remains well below the statewide rate of 24.2%. The school also achieves these results while spending less per pupil ($8,539) than every nearby comparison school with available data. For parents, the key takeaway is that Fair Grove clearly excels at upper-grade science and math instruction and serves many high-need students well, but the persistent early-literacy gap—plus growing attendance concerns—are the challenges most likely to hold the school back in future years.
